Job description: OverviewAccelerating Measurable Progress and Leveraging Investments for PPH Impact (AMPLIPPHI) is a two- and half-year project that will catalyze early adoption and set the stage for scale up of new and recently recommended drugs for postpartum hemorrhage (PPH) in high-burden countries with a focus on DRC, Guinea, India, Kenya, Nigeria and Zambia. AMPLI- Nigeria will generate evidence (feasibility, acceptability, costing) to support the expansion of new PPH medicines at all different levels of the health system. Project is focused on supporting efforts towards State and national readiness, from community to district and national level stakeholders, to help propel scale-up after life of project. Implementation is in 2 LGAs in Kebbi State and 3 LGAs in Ondo State.Project is currently conducting a study to generate evidence on barriers and opportunities for operationalizing WHO and national guidelines for advance distribution of misoprostol for PPH prevention at births outside of health facilities in Nigeria. This assessment is being conducted in FCT, Niger, Sokoto, Abuja and Akwa Ibom states.Specific objectives are to:1. Explore values, experiences and contextual factors that could influence policymaker and health professional association endorsement and scale-up of advance distribution of misoprostol for PPH prevention at births outside of health facilities.2. Assess policymaker and health professional association perspectives on health system readiness to implement advance distribution of misoprostol for PPH prevention at births outside of health facilities.The Research Assistants will facilitate key informant interviews in Niger, Sokoto, Abuja and Akwa Ibom states, including consent, transcription of recording, and detailed notes during the interviews.Overall ResponsibilityCollect quality and reliable data for the Misoprostol Assessment Study.Specific ResponsibilitiesWorking closely with the field supervisors and the data manager, you are to * Participate in the data collection training for data collectors in Abuja.
